Understanding Door Hinge Pins: A Comprehensive Guide

Door hinge pins play a necessary yet frequently ignored function in the functionality of doors. Regardless of being tiny in size, these pins are essential in protecting the door to its frame and enabling it to swing open and closed smoothly. This article explores the different kinds of door hinge pins, their functions, installation procedures, and common issues related to them.

What Are Door Hinge Pins?

Door hinge pins are cylindrical rods inserted through the knuckles of a hinge, allowing the hinge to pivot. The hinge itself consists of 2 plates connected to the door and door frame, with the pin handling the load and helping with motion. A well-functioning hinge pin guarantees that the door runs quietly and effectively.

How to Install Door Hinge Pins

Installing door hinge pins is an uncomplicated process that can be accomplished with a few basic tools. Below is a step-by-step guide:

Step-by-Step Installation Guide

  1. Collect Tools: You will need a hammer, replacement pins, and perhaps a screwdriver.

  2. Eliminate the Old Pin: If changing an old hinge pin, use a hammer to gently tap the pin up, removing it from the hinge.

  3. Align the Hinge: Hold the hinge in location on the door and door frame. Ensure it is lined up effectively.

  4. Place the New Pin: Carefully move the new pin into the upper hinge knuckle first, then down through the lower knuckle.

  5. Check the Movement: Open and close the door to ensure it swings smoothly and the hinge is lined up.

  6. Protect Everything: If needed, tighten up any screws or bolts on the hinge plates to secure them in place.

Typical Issues with Door Hinge Pins

While door hinge pins are developed for durability, issues can develop. Here are some common problems and services:

IssueDescriptionOption
Door Won't Close CompletelyThe door is not aligned with the frame.Adjust the hinge or replace the pin.
Squeaking NoisesBrought on by friction due to absence of lubrication.Lube the hinges routinely.
Rusty PinsCorrosion can compromise the hinge structure.Replace rusty pins and think about utilizing stainless steel.
Pin is StuckDirt or deterioration can avoid the pin from being gotten rid of.Apply permeating oil and carefully tap.
